The Biological Bridge: How D3 Impacts Erections
So, how exactly does vitamin D3 connect with the intricate mechanisms that govern an erection? The link is multifaceted and touches upon several key physiological pathways.
- Endothelial Function and Nitric Oxide Production: This is arguably one of the most significant connections. The endothelium is the thin layer of cells lining the inside of our blood vessels. A healthy endothelium is crucial for good blood flow because it produces nitric oxide (NO), a powerful vasodilator that helps relax and widen blood vessels. For an erection to occur, NO needs to be released in the penis, allowing blood to rush in and fill the spongy tissues. Low vitamin D levels are associated with endothelial dysfunction, meaning these cells don’t work as effectively, leading to reduced NO production. If your blood vessels, including those tiny ones in the penis, aren’t expanding properly, achieving and sustaining an erection becomes a real challenge. Think of it like a garden hose: if the hose is stiff and constricted, the water flow will be weak. Vitamin D helps keep that hose flexible and open.
- Testosterone Levels: While not the sole factor, testosterone plays a vital role in libido and erectile quality. Studies have shown a correlation between low vitamin D levels and lower total testosterone in men. Vitamin D receptors are found in the Leydig cells of the testes, which are responsible for testosterone production. While direct causation (that supplementing D3 *always* significantly boosts testosterone) is still being explored and isn’t a guaranteed outcome for everyone, improving vitamin D status *can* contribute to more optimal hormonal balance, which in turn supports healthy erectile function.
- Inflammation and Oxidative Stress: Chronic inflammation and oxidative stress are known culprits in damaging blood vessels and contributing to various chronic diseases, including cardiovascular disease and diabetes – both major risk factors for ED. Vitamin D possesses potent anti-inflammatory and antioxidant properties. By helping to quell systemic inflammation and reduce oxidative damage, vitamin D can protect the delicate endothelial cells and blood vessels, thereby supporting their ability to function correctly for an erection.
- Blood Vessel Health and Arterial Stiffness: As mentioned, ED is often a harbinger of cardiovascular issues. Vitamin D contributes to overall arterial health by reducing arterial stiffness and improving vascular compliance. Stiff arteries, particularly the penile arteries, can impair blood flow, making it harder to achieve and maintain an erection. By helping maintain the elasticity and health of these vessels, vitamin D indirectly supports erectile function.
What Does the Science Say? The Evidence Unpacked
When it comes to the science behind vitamin D3 and ED, the picture is continuously evolving, but the trends are certainly encouraging. We’re moving beyond anecdotal observations and into more rigorous scientific inquiry.
Observational Studies and Associations
Numerous observational studies have consistently shown a strong association between low vitamin D levels and an increased risk of ED. For instance, a notable study published in the journal *Atherosclerosis* found that men with severe vitamin D deficiency (levels below 20 ng/mL) were significantly more likely to experience ED compared to men with sufficient levels. Another large population-based study in the *Journal of Sexual Medicine* concluded that insufficient vitamin D levels were independently associated with ED, even after accounting for other cardiovascular risk factors. These studies, while not proving direct causation, certainly raise a strong red flag, suggesting that vitamin D status is a critical piece of the ED puzzle.
Intervention Studies and Supplementation Trials
The real test, however, comes from intervention studies where vitamin D is supplemented, and its impact on ED is measured. While the body of evidence is still growing, several trials have yielded promising results. One such study involved men with both ED and vitamin D deficiency. After being supplemented with vitamin D for a period, many participants reported significant improvements in their erectile function scores, often alongside an increase in their testosterone levels. These improvements weren’t always a “cure” but represented a substantial step in the right direction for many. It’s important to note that the degree of improvement can vary widely, and factors like the severity of the deficiency, the presence of other health conditions, and individual responses all play a role.

So, How Much Vitamin D3 Do You Actually Need?
This is the million-dollar question, and frankly, there isn’t a one-size-fits-all answer. Your ideal dosage of vitamin D3 for erectile dysfunction, or for general health, is highly individualized. It depends on your current vitamin D status, your body’s ability to absorb it, your lifestyle, and any underlying health conditions. This is where the “don’t guess, test” mantra becomes paramount.
Defining “Optimal” Vitamin D Levels
Most health organizations generally consider a blood level of 25-hydroxyvitamin D (the storage form measured in blood tests) to be sufficient if it’s above 20 ng/mL (50 nmol/L). However, many experts in the field, myself included, advocate for what’s often termed an “optimal” range, which is typically between 30-60 ng/mL (75-150 nmol/L), and sometimes even up to 80 ng/mL for certain conditions. Within this optimal range, the body’s various systems, including those involved in erectile function, seem to operate at their best.
| Vitamin D Blood Level (25-hydroxyvitamin D) | Interpretation | Clinical Implication for ED Support |
|---|---|---|
| < 12 ng/mL (< 30 nmol/L) | Severe Deficiency | High likelihood of contributing to ED; requires aggressive repletion. |
| 12-20 ng/mL (30-50 nmol/L) | Deficiency | Commonly observed in men with ED; repletion highly recommended. |
| 20-30 ng/mL (50-75 nmol/L) | Insufficiency / Low Normal | May still benefit from supplementation to reach optimal levels for ED support. |
| 30-60 ng/mL (75-150 nmol/L) | Optimal Range | Associated with better health outcomes, including endothelial function relevant to ED. Maintenance may be needed. |
| > 60 ng/mL (> 150 nmol/L) | High Normal / Elevated | Generally considered safe, but higher levels might not offer additional ED benefit; monitor closely. |
| > 100 ng/mL (> 250 nmol/L) | Potentially Toxic | Risk of adverse effects; immediate reduction in dosage is necessary. |

General Recommendations for Deficient Individuals
If you’re found to be deficient (typically below 20 ng/mL), your doctor will likely recommend a therapeutic dose to bring your levels up to the optimal range. This phase is often referred to as “repletion.”
- Daily Dosing: For moderate to severe deficiency, a common starting point might be 5,000 IU to 10,000 IU of vitamin D3 daily for 2-3 months. This higher dose helps to quickly replenish your stores.
- Weekly or Bi-Weekly Dosing (Loading Doses): Sometimes, doctors might prescribe larger, less frequent doses, such as 50,000 IU once a week or every two weeks for a period. This can be more convenient for some individuals, but it’s essential to follow medical advice precisely.
- Maintenance Dosing: Once your levels are in the optimal range (e.g., 30-60 ng/mL), the goal shifts to maintaining them. A typical maintenance dose for adults without significant sun exposure often ranges from 2,000 IU to 4,000 IU daily. Some individuals, especially those with darker skin, obesity, or certain medical conditions, might require slightly higher maintenance doses.
Factors Influencing Your Dose
Several factors can affect how much vitamin D3 you need:
- Skin Type and Sun Exposure: People with darker skin tones produce less vitamin D from sun exposure. If you live in a northern latitude, spend most of your time indoors, or always use sunscreen, your natural vitamin D production will be limited.
- Weight: Vitamin D is fat-soluble. Individuals with obesity may require higher doses because vitamin D can get “sequestered” in fat cells, making it less bioavailable in the bloodstream.
- Age: As we age, our skin’s ability to synthesize vitamin D from sunlight decreases.
- Medical Conditions: Conditions like Crohn’s disease, celiac disease, cystic fibrosis, or kidney disease can impair vitamin D absorption or metabolism, necessitating higher doses. Certain medications, like some anticonvulsants or steroids, can also affect vitamin D metabolism.

Choosing the Right Supplement: D3 (Cholecalciferol)
When you head to the pharmacy or health store, you’ll likely see two main forms of vitamin D: D2 (ergocalciferol) and D3 (cholecalciferol). Always go for vitamin D3. It’s the same form your body naturally produces when exposed to sunlight and is generally more effective at raising and maintaining vitamin D levels in the blood. Look for brands that are transparent about their sourcing and manufacturing, and if possible, those with third-party certifications.
Absorption Boosters: Fat is Your Friend
Remember, vitamin D is a fat-soluble vitamin. This means it needs dietary fat to be properly absorbed into your bloodstream. Taking your vitamin D3 supplement with a meal that contains some healthy fats – think avocado, nuts, seeds, olive oil, or fatty fish – can significantly improve its absorption. Just popping it with a glass of water on an empty stomach might mean you’re not getting the full benefit.

Potential Side Effects and Toxicity (Rare, But Real)
While vitamin D is generally safe, taking excessively high doses for prolonged periods can lead to toxicity, though this is rare and usually only happens with mega-doses far exceeding typical recommendations. The main concern with vitamin D toxicity is hypercalcemia, which is an excess of calcium in the blood. This happens because vitamin D increases calcium absorption.
-
Symptoms of Vitamin D Toxicity:
- Nausea, vomiting, and loss of appetite
- Constipation or diarrhea
- Excessive thirst and frequent urination
- Weakness, fatigue, and muscle pain
- Confusion and disorientation
- Kidney problems (in severe, prolonged cases)
If you experience any of these symptoms while taking vitamin D, contact your doctor immediately. Again, this is why professional guidance and monitoring are so important.
- Calcium and Vitamin K2: The Dynamic Duo: When supplementing with vitamin D3, especially at higher doses, it’s often wise to consider the interplay with other nutrients. Vitamin K2, for instance, works synergistically with D3 to ensure calcium is deposited in the right places (bones and teeth) and kept out of the wrong places (arteries and soft tissues). Many experts suggest that if you’re taking more than 5,000 IU of vitamin D3 daily, you might also want to consider a K2 supplement, after discussing it with your doctor. Magnesium is another vital co-factor, as it’s required for the activation of vitamin D in the body. If your magnesium levels are low, even high doses of D3 might not be fully effective. A balanced approach means looking at the bigger nutritional picture.

Addressing Underlying Health Conditions
As I noted earlier, ED is frequently a red flag for other serious health issues. Ignoring these underlying conditions means you’re only treating a symptom, not the root cause. This is why a thorough medical evaluation is so important.
- Diabetes: Poorly controlled blood sugar levels can damage blood vessels and nerves, leading to ED. Effective diabetes management is crucial.
- Hypertension (High Blood Pressure): High blood pressure damages the lining of blood vessels and can impair nitric oxide production. Managing blood pressure through lifestyle and medication is vital.
- Heart Disease and Atherosclerosis: Clogged arteries that restrict blood flow to the heart can also restrict blood flow to the penis. ED can be an early indicator of developing cardiovascular issues, making a complete cardiac workup essential.
- Hormonal Imbalances: Low testosterone (hypogonadism) is a common cause of ED and can be identified and treated by an endocrinologist.

Are there any risks to taking high doses of Vitamin D3?
Yes, while vitamin D3 is generally safe when taken within recommended guidelines, taking excessively high doses for prolonged periods carries risks. The primary concern is vitamin D toxicity, also known as hypervitaminosis D, which can lead to dangerously high levels of calcium in the blood (hypercalcemia). Symptoms of hypercalcemia can include nausea, vomiting, constipation, excessive thirst, frequent urination, fatigue, muscle weakness, and in severe cases, kidney damage or heart rhythm abnormalities. This is why medical supervision is absolutely critical, especially when starting with higher therapeutic doses to correct a deficiency. Your doctor will monitor your blood levels (25-hydroxyvitamin D and sometimes calcium) to ensure you remain within a safe and effective range, adjusting your dosage as needed to prevent any adverse effects. Never exceed the recommended dose without explicit medical advice.
What are the best food sources of Vitamin D3?
While sun exposure is the primary natural source of vitamin D, and supplementation is often necessary, certain foods do contain vitamin D3. However, it’s important to understand that it can be challenging to meet your full vitamin D needs through diet alone. The best dietary sources of vitamin D3 include:
- Fatty fish: Salmon, mackerel, tuna, and sardines are excellent sources. A serving of cooked salmon, for example, can provide a significant portion of your daily needs.
- Cod liver oil: Historically used as a supplement, it’s a potent source of vitamin D and often vitamin A.
- Fortified foods: Many dairy products (milk, yogurt), plant-based milks (almond, soy, oat milk), cereals, and orange juice are fortified with vitamin D. Check the nutrition labels for specific amounts.
- Egg yolks: While they contain some vitamin D, you’d need to eat quite a few to make a substantial impact.
- Mushrooms (UV-treated): Some mushrooms, particularly those exposed to UV light, can provide vitamin D2, which is less effective than D3 but still contributes to overall levels.
Relying solely on diet for optimal vitamin D levels, especially for individuals with deficiency, is often insufficient, making strategic supplementation a more reliable route.

Can I get enough Vitamin D3 from sun exposure alone?
For many people, especially those living in certain geographical regions or with specific lifestyles, getting enough vitamin D3 from sun exposure alone can be challenging, if not impossible. Several factors influence how much vitamin D your skin produces from sunlight:
- Geographic Latitude: If you live north of about 37 degrees latitude (roughly a line from San Francisco to Washington D.C.) during the winter months, the sun’s angle is too low for effective vitamin D synthesis.
- Time of Day: Midday sun (10 AM to 3 PM) is most effective.
- Skin Pigmentation: Darker skin tones require significantly more sun exposure than lighter skin tones to produce the same amount of vitamin D.
- Sunscreen Use: Sunscreen, while vital for skin protection, blocks UV B rays, which are necessary for vitamin D production.
- Clothing and Lifestyle: Covering up or spending most of your time indoors drastically limits exposure.
- Age: As we age, our skin’s ability to synthesize vitamin D decreases.
While smart, moderate sun exposure can contribute to your vitamin D levels, relying solely on it is often impractical or insufficient to correct a deficiency or maintain optimal levels, especially when addressing specific health concerns like ED. Many healthcare professionals therefore recommend a combination of diet, sun, and supplementation to ensure adequate levels.
